Sparagowski & Associates conducted a study of service times at the drive-up window of fast-food restaurants. The average time between placing an order and receiving the order at McDonald’s restaurants was 2.78 minutes (The Cincinnati Enquirer, July 9, 2000). Waiting times, such as these, frequently follow an exponential distribution.
a. What is the probability that a customer’s service time is less than 2 minutes?
b. What is the probability that a customer’s service time is more than 5 minutes?
c. What is the probability that a customer’s service time is more than 2.78 minutes?
